Transaction ed33964b2fc74efabf583515b675118d13c490c4a1e7ef86cab745594701fd14
1 Input
1 Output
-
ed33964b2fc74efabf583515b675118d13c490c4a1e7ef86cab745594701fd14:0
- value
- 289673
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d981a3025989cb7fe5a73b3fa2c8587ba6a6d1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lq4vwv6vcWS4zCfd2VUAsJ8qqtnFQQd2y